The verb that describes the action of pushing food through the pharynx is "swallow."

The pharynx is a muscular tube that is part of both the digestive and respiratory systems in humans and many other animals. It is commonly known as the throat. The pharynx extends from the base of the skull to the level of the sixth cervical vertebra (the sixth bone in the neck).

During swallowing, the muscles of the pharynx contract in a coordinated manner, propelling food or liquid from the mouth to the esophagus. The pharynx also plays a crucial role in preventing food or liquid from entering the trachea (windpipe) by directing it into the esophagus instead.

In addition to its role in digestion and respiration, the pharynx is important for speech production. It serves as a resonating chamber for sound and contributes to the formation of certain speech sounds.

Identify each statement as a correlation or a causation. Explain your reasoning. A. The larger a person's shoe size, the higher a person's reading level. B. The more car accidents a person is involved in results in a higher rate for car insurance premiums.

Answers

Answer: Statement A is a correlation, and Statement B is a causation.

Explanation:

Correlation means that there is a statistical relationship between two variables, but it does not imply causation. Whereas, causation implies a cause-and-effect relationship between variables. Now let me explain how our two sentences are- correlation and causation.

Sentence A: The larger a person's shoe size, the higher a person's reading level.

The shoe size and reading level are unconnected in this situation. Due to the fact that both factors tend to rise with age, they could be correlated. The assertion does not, however, imply that having a larger shoe size immediately results in having a better reading level or vice versa.

Statement B: The more car accidents a person is involved in results in the higher rate for car insurance premiums.

Causation is described by this sentence. In this situation, it makes sense to expect that having more auto accidents will result in paying more for insurance. A history of auto accidents suggests a higher chance of future accidents and insurance firms base rate determination on risk assessment. As a result, the cause is the number of auto accidents, and the impact is the rise in insurance rates.

Looking at the Miranda case, you see several headnotes with Topics and Sub-Topics.What is the Sub-Topic for Headnote #64?

Answers

The Sub-Topic for Headnote #64 is "Compulsion of Testimony."

This Sub-Topic deals with the Fifth Amendment of the U.S. Constitution which states that no person "shall be compelled in any criminal case to be a witness against himself."

This means that a person cannot be forced to provide incriminating evidence against themselves. This is known as the right against self-incrimination.

In the Miranda case, the Supreme Court held that when a suspect is in police custody and is subjected to interrogation, they must be informed of their right to remain silent and that anything they say may be used as evidence against them.

The Court held that any statements made in response to interrogation must be voluntary and that any statements made under coercion or compulsion are inadmissible in a criminal trial.
